Its a good pipe, I wouldn't be overly concerned about running a longer header on a rear exhaust engine. Having the longer version would be ideal but it should still run well. I did the same thing years ago with the original Irwin pipes. First I started with a novarossi LS then later put it on a Mac21 inboard. I modified a damaged header and had a local shop tig weld a piece of aluminum tubing to to the flange extending its length. Worked like a charm. Its basically the same thing as 180 header, its just a straight tube instead of a bent one. Could always make a tapered header also...
